The GlenAllachie Distillery in Scotland has legendary grasp distiller Billy Walker at its helm, who took it over from earlier possession in 2017 alongside some companions. Positioned on the foot of Ben Rinnes within the coronary heart of Speyside, one among Walker’s early targets was to develop a peated whisky for GlenAllachie. To this finish, in 2018, his crew laid down the primary casks of what, 5 years later, has turn out to be often known as the brand new Meikle Tòir (which means Large Pursuit) lineup.

As a part of this peated whisky focus, Walker used mainland peat from St. Fergus versus the extra well-known Islay peat. Mainland peat, fashioned from the breakdown of timber versus herbs and seaweed frequent to Islay, creates what he describes as “a a lot sweeter smoke fashion.” GlenAllachie is producing solely 100,000 liters of this alcohol yearly throughout simply six weeks every year.

Moreover, all Meikle Tòir expressions are subjected to a prolonged fermentation time of 160 hours – practically triple the trade common – which the Walker feels “provides a fruity, ester-rich character to the next whisky.”

“Each ingredient of the manufacturing course of was rigorously thought of to make sure our imaginative and prescient was met,” mentioned Walker on the time of this whisky’s launch. “It’s not about accelerating the journey; it’s about increasing the expertise. One of many key selections was to considerably lengthen the fermentation interval to 160 hours, creating thick, ester-rich distillate. One other was to make use of mainland peat, which delivers a extra oaky fashion of smoke. These decisions, together with using high quality oak casks, are all components steering us in our pursuit of peated perfection.”

The whisky I’m reviewing at the moment, Meikle Tòir The Turbo, is one among 4 making up this model’s core lineup. Aged for 5 years in a mix of three American virgin oak casks and 5 Oloroso hogsheads, this peated Scotch has a 50% ABV and a peat score of 71 ppm. It’s of pure shade and is non-chill filtered, priced at $75.
